Richard Harrison Brock January 5, 1917 – March 4, 2011

  Richard Harrison Brock, son of Edward and Mary Olive (Jones) Brock, was born January 5, 1917 at Jewell, Iowa. On May 11, 1940, Richard married Esther Vold. He farmed near Woolstock and was also the service manager at Jones Implement in Woolstock. After retiring, they enjoyed winters in Texas. Richard enjoyed cards, dominos and square dancing. In 2003 he moved into Webster City and in October 2008 he moved into the Health Care Center in Mount Ayr.

Richard passed away the morning of March 4, 2011. He was preceded  in death by his parents; wife; brothers, Vic and wife Bev Brock and Roger and wife Hazel Brock; sister, Edna Heng and husband Marion, and brother-in-law, LaVerne Anfinson.

Survivors include his children, Dean (Ann) Brock of Lacanada, California, Bruce (Janet) Brock of Altoona, Iowa, Wayne (Tonna) Brock of McKinney, Texas, Cheri (Kevin) Dessinger of Mount Ayr, Iowa and Gloria (Doug) Kinseth of Fort Dodge, Iowa; 11 grandchildren including Kris (Clint) Spurrier of Mount Ayr, Iowa; 16 great-grandchildren; six great-great-grandchildren; sister, Frances Anfinson of Webster City, Iowa, and other relatives and friends.

Mr. Brock was cremated and a memorial service is being planned in May 2011 in Webster City, Iowa.

Watson-Armstrong Funeral Home in Mount Ayr is in charge of the local arrangements.
